2017-08-16 30 views
-1

我已经反应组件Button.js,它可以接收几个道具:typeonClicktext。我写我的测试,以确定是否组件接收道具,而是在写与酶测试中,我可以看到,有些道具是未定义返回undefined即使我通过他们。酶并没有看到反应组分的所有道具

组件和测试的代码是here

回答

0

我相信这里的问题是,你是通过道具的按钮,但使用的文字道具作为按钮的实际文本。如果在DOM(HTML)存在的文本

尝试测试。那么应该通过罚款。

+0

'希望(wrapper.text())toEqual( '测试');'<<<原来这是测试的方式 –

相关问题